    Breeding with Crystal Unicorn.......

    I've spent so much time trying to acquire the Crystal Unicorn that I have spent very little time thinking of its proper use. I will have my CU in a little less than 40 hours.....so what should be my strategy in using it? I am so tired of 4 element breeding it will be nice to be able to get away from it.

    I would be interested to know just how much some of you use the CU from the standpoint of breeding and in tournaments.

    After I first bred a Crystal Unicorn, I raised it to Level 15 as soon as possible and use it often during tournaments. It is strong against Nature and Earth and doubly Strong against Earth/Nature hybrids, so there are plenty of opponents it is good against.

    As for breeding, I did not have any luck breeding a Gem Hybrid until I accidently bred a second Unicorn while trying for the Teddy Bear as part of a Trio (required 4 elements). I raised the second one to level 4 and use it all the time for breeding while the level 15 Unicorn fights. I have tried over 100 times to breed a Gem Hybrid with a single element common but never managed one that way. I generally use a Crystal Unicorn as one parent for virtually all my breeding attempts. Since the beginning of the year, I have bred 2 Gem hybrids this way while my main intent was to breed something else. For instance, I am trying for the Palmeranian, I am using a Crystal Unicorn and a Porkupine (Electric/Nature) as parents.

    Good Luck going forward, at least now you get to try for a Gem Hybrid.

    Firstly: BIG congrats on having bred the Crystal Unicorn!
    Despite hundreds of 4-element attempts, I never succeeded at that, so I bought 2 of them during the Black Friday sales.
    I made one (Jasper) an epic, and kept the other (Krystal) at level 9 (as I like the Juvenile form).
    Nowadays, either one of them pretty much constantly occupies the breeding den. There's pretty much no breeding that I make without using a Unicorn as one of the parents (same process as ninasidstorm8 describes). I have, however, been lucky in breeding out gem hybrids with the Unicorn + single element formulas. The Unicorn + Pyro Pony formula resulted with surprising ease in two Ruby Razorbacks (IIRC, the first one after some 10-20 attempts and the second one after some 10-20 more attempts). It took some more efforts to breed out the Garnet Griffin this way, again, I don't remember the exact amount, but from memory I think around 50-65 attempts or so, which is still pretty good for a gem hybrid.
    The others were bred differently: my Emerald Dragon was bred in a 4-element attempt with my bought Quartz Quetzalcoatl (my first gem animal) on the 101st breeding with the QQ. My Pearl Peryton recently was acquired with the level 15 Unicorn + Winter Equifox (as a 'fail' when trying for Zeus Moose), and only a few days ago I got the Jade Kirin with my level 9 Unicorn + Swan Prince (as a 'fail' when trying for the French Hen).

    As for combat: despite the Unicorn being a great fighter, I use it surprisingly little for that. I prefer to use hybrids, but sometimes I pull my epic Unicorn from the stable in order to help me out in the arena. During tournaments I try to keep my level 15 Unicorn at the arena's disposition, while the level 9 one does its thing in the breeding den. This is also why the Jade Kirin was bred with the level 9 Unicorn, whereas Pearl Peryton was bred with the level 15 one.

    Have fun in the breeding with it, and don't get frustrated if it takes a lot of attempts to breed out a hybrid. If you explicitly want to try and breed out a hybrid, go for Unicorn + Pyro Pony first for having shots at the Ruby Razorback and the Garnet Griffin, or go with the Unicorn + Pandaffodil for having shots at the Quartz Quetzalcoatl and the Emerald Dragon.

    I use my CU in breeding almost all the time unless I really don't want a long timer because of a zodiac or similar event. I may not be actively trying for a gem hybrid, but leave the door open to the possibility by using my CU or a gem hybrid.

    During a tournament, I rarely use my CU even though it is epic. I do have a lot of epic animals though and usually have several good options for each battle. Sometimes I scan the upcoming battles to see how likely it is that I'll need the CU before breeding. If you don't have many options for battling, maybe you should keep your CU available during tournaments.

    Can you not breed a CU with something with water/fire elements?
    No, None of the Water/Fire animals can be used as parents. There have been occasions in the past when S8 made a mistake and one could be a parent for a short period of time and the result was lots of Ruby Razorbacks (there were no Gem/Water animals at the time).
